Phased arrays like the 7S pack tightly spaced elements into a small footprint – edge-element failures distort the sector image early, and cardiac duty cycles accelerate cable fatigue.

Common failure modes for the 7S

Match what you are seeing against the table below. The right-hand column reflects how faults of this kind typically assess – the actual verdict always depends on the individual probe.

What you see Likely cause Typically repairable?
Latch or locking hardware damaged on the connector shell Broken locking mechanics on the connector housing Usually repairable
Visible nicks, grooves or staining on the lens surface Wear from use, or chemical attack from disinfectants Usually repairable
Bubbles or lifting at the lens face Lens delamination from the acoustic stack Usually repairable
Fuzzy or noisy image that cleaning does not fix A worn lens surface or elements beginning to degrade Case by case
Large areas of the array not firing Widespread element or acoustic stack failure Usually not economical
Split seams or impact marks on the probe body Impact damage; housing can usually be replaced or resealed Usually repairable
Vertical shadowing or missing scan lines on screen Failed transducer elements or a broken conductor in the cable Case by case
Sector image narrows or loses the apex Element failure concentrated at the array edge Case by case

Check these before you ship the probe

  • Examine the connector for bent or corroded pins, cracks and a working locking mechanism.
  • Compare penetration and uniformity against a known-good probe on the same preset.
  • Flex the cable gently along its length while imaging – intermittent dropout points to broken conductors.
  • Photograph the complete manufacturer label – the exact revision matters for parts compatibility.
  • Run the system’s built-in probe test or element check if your console provides one.

Repair, exchange or replace — which applies to your 7S

Three paths apply to a failing 7S: repair (typical for lens, housing, cable and connector damage), exchange (fastest route back to scanning) or replacement (when the acoustic stack is too far gone). The deciding factors are how much of the array still fires, whether the housing is intact and what downtime costs you. Each probe is judged on its actual condition.
